Under Armour has tapped actor Dwayne Johnson to be the new face of the sports apparel brand.

The "Ballers" star will collaborate with the label to create a range of products including footwear, apparel and accessories.

Likewise, the brand will develop capsule collections inspired by Johnson's films and projects, like the Rock-inspired backpack and duffle pack which is set to launch at their online shop.

The overall campaign will be inspired by the actor and former WWE wrestler's lifestyle and fitness regime.

Johnson joins other elite athletes in fronting the Under Armour label including Stephen Curry, Tom Brady, Misty Copeland, Lindsey Vonn, Andy Murray and Michael Phelps.
